What is the average salary in Langhorne, PA?

The average salary in Langhorne, PA is $54,444 per year.

Langhorne, PA, offers a variety of job opportunities with competitive salaries. People in this area earn an average yearly salary of $54,444. This makes it a good place for job seekers to consider. The salary range is broad, with jobs offering salaries from $26,000 to over $140,000 per year.


Most people earn between $26,000 and $78,955 each year. This range includes many different types of jobs. For instance, some of the most common jobs include office workers and skilled trades. Higher paying jobs include roles in management and specialized professions. This mix allows job seekers to find roles that match their skills and experience levels.

What are the best paying jobs in Langhorne, PA?

Langhorne, PA, offers several job opportunities with competitive salaries. Among the highest paying jobs are positions such as Behavior Analyst and Registered Nurse. These roles not only provide attractive compensation but also offer rewarding work environments. Behavior Analysts earn an average salary of $89,706 per year, making it one of the top-paying jobs in the area. Registered Nurses follow closely with an average salary of $87,304 annually. These positions require specialized training, which allows professionals to provide essential services and achieve financial stability.

How does the cost of living in Langhorne, PA compare to the national average?

Langhorne, PA, displays a higher cost of living compared to the nationwide average. The cost of living index stands at 106, which is 6% above the national benchmark of 100. The housing index in Langhorne is notably 20% higher, while the healthcare costs are also 10% above average. In contrast, utilities and miscellaneous costs are slightly below the national average, at 5% and 2% lower, respectively. This balanced set of data indicates that while housing and healthcare are pricier in Langhorne, other expenses remain relatively comparable to the nationwide averages.

Langhorne, Pennsylvania, showcases a cost of living that diverges slightly from the national average. Housing costs in Langhorne stand at 120 on the cost of living index, which is 20% higher than the national average of 100. This means that renters and homeowners can anticipate spending more on their residences compared to the average American.


When examining other expenses, Langhorne's cost of living remains closely aligned with the national average. For instance, groceries cost 104 on the index, which is a modest 4% increase. Utilities and transportation also hover near the national average, with indices of 95 and 102, respectively. Healthcare costs are slightly higher at 110, indicating a 10% increase. Miscellaneous expenses are at 98, which is 2% below the national average. Overall, Langhorne presents a housing market that is notably pricier than the rest of the country, while other essential costs are fairly comparable.
